Product Description:
The HDS02.1-W040N-HS45-01-FW is a modular drive controller produced by Bosch Rexroth Indramat within the HDS Drive Controllers series. Designed for use in multi-axis DIAX04 systems, the unit supplies regulated power and coordinated motion control to servo axes in packaging, material handling, and machining equipment. In automated systems, it converts available DC-bus power into controlled motor current so connected axes can follow speed, torque, and position commands. The controller is intended for applications that require accurate axis response and dependable coordination across several drive modules.
Communication with the control system is handled through the SERCOS fiber-optic interface, allowing high-speed cyclic data exchange and real-time diagnostics. This connection supports synchronized command transfer between the controller and the higher-level control platform during multi-axis operation. The power stage is rated for a continuous output of 40 A, so the controller can supply substantial current to medium-frame servo axes without external boosters. Its current capacity is suitable for repeated acceleration and steady-state running on medium-power machinery axes. Heat generated by the electronics is removed by a built-in internal air blower, which helps keep the module within its thermal range. Electrical insulation is rated to class C under DIN VDE 0110. The housing has an IP 10 protection rating under DIN 40 050, so it is protected against accidental finger contact and is intended for installation in a closed control cabinet.
The controller operates at full current in ambient temperatures from +5 °C to +45 °C. Above this range, the output must be derated, and the maximum permitted ambient temperature is +55 °C. Continuous service is permitted at installation heights up to 1000 m above sea level, where normal cooling performance can be maintained. During storage or transport, the electronics can withstand temperatures from -30 °C to +85 °C. These operating limits apply to normal cabinet installation with appropriate airflow around the module. The product is part of line 02 and version 1 within the DIAX04 platform.
